Your Role as a Product & Sales Training Specialist As a Product & Sales Training Specialist, you will be responsible for developing and delivering high-impact learning experiences that strengthen product knowledge, sales effectiveness, and customer engagement across the Mercedes-Benz Retailer Network. Through the delivery of engaging face-to-face and virtual training that translates complex vehicle technology into compelling customer-facing value. You will work closely with internal Sales, Product, and Marketing teams to align training content with local market needs . Key Duties & Responsibilities · Design and deliver engaging Product, Sales Systems & Sales training programs, both face-to-face and virtual, with a strong emphasis on vehicle features, competitive positioning, customer benefits, and sales conversations. · Translate technical vehicle information (including BEV and High-Voltage technologies) into clear, customer-relevant messaging for sales and customer-facing roles. · Collaborate closely with Sales, Product Management, and Marketing teams to support product launches, campaigns, and brand consistency. · Review, localise, and maintain training materials to ensure relevance for the Australian and New Zealand markets. · Act as a subject-matter expert for Retailers, providing guidance on product knowledge, value propositions, sales systems and customer engagement best practices. · Participate in Train-the-Trainer activities to continuously enhance facilitation capability and product expertise. · Contribute to the day-to-day operations of the Training Academy, ensuring all Health, Safety, and Environment (HSE) requirements are met. · Support the wider Training Academy team as required. · This role requires occasional domestic and international travel. What You Will Need to Be Successful · Demonstrated experience in product training, sales training, or automotive retail operations. · Strong understanding of automotive products, with electric and hybrid vehicle knowledge highly regarded. · Proven ability to deliver engaging classroom or virtual learning experiences, including the ability to work with Digital training and digital media. · Capability to translate complex or technical content into persuasive customer-facing language. · Excellent communication, facilitation, and stakeholder engagement skills. · Strong organisational and time-management capabilities in a dynamic environment. · Ability to work autonomously while collaborating effectively within a broader team. · Proficiency in Microsoft Word, PowerPoint, and Excel , coupled with a high level of adaptability and openness to incorporating AI and automation tools into daily work. · A flexible, agile, and adaptable mindset with a strong passion for learning and development.
